Plot

In the comedic whirlwind that is Parents, Jenny Pope, a once domineering business maven, finds herself jobless after an ill-tempered punch at a colleague. Meanwhile, her husband Nick, unemployed yet adventurous, has gambled their entire nest egg on a dubious business venture. Their tranquil London life crumbles in a single day, compelling them and their adolescent children, Sam and Becky, to make a drastic relocation up north - right into the welcoming arms of Jenny's parents, Len and Alma. Billed as a brief respite, this move soon spirals into a chaotic, hilarious, and often heartwarming cohabitation of three generations under a single roof. Len and Alma, who thought they had bidden farewell to the days of parenting, now find their retirement disrupted. Jenny and Nick, who had relished their independence from parental oversight, are suddenly thrust back into the world of parental curfews and unsolicited advice. Sam and Becky, caught in the crossfire, must navigate the trials and tribulations of adolescence with a pair of parents and grandparents who have wildly contrasting ideologies on child rearing. Parents is a rapid-fire comedy, a vivid portrait of a family both at odds and in unison, a testament to the trials, joys, and absurdities of multi-generational living.
